Personal Information
Name: William Cross
Gender: Male
Born: 1st Jan 1815
Death: 1st Jan 1850
Age at death: 35
Occupation: Unknown
Crime
Crime: Stealing a watch
Convicted at: Devon, Exeter General Quarter Sessions
Sentence term: 10 years
Voyage
Departed: 10th Aug 1842
Ship: Moffatt
Arrival: 28th Nov 1842
Place of Arrival: Van Diemen's Land
Transportation
William Cross was transported on the Moffatt, departing 10th Aug 1842 and arriving 28th Nov 1842 with 391 passengers.
